Management of Lower Extremity Edema Despite Bumetanide with eGFR 40

Increase the bumetanide dose progressively and consider adding metolazone for sequential nephron blockade, as loop diuretics maintain efficacy even with severely impaired renal function and dose escalation is the cornerstone of managing breakthrough edema. 1, 2

Immediate Diuretic Optimization

Escalate loop diuretic dosing aggressively:

  • Increase bumetanide dose progressively until urine output increases and weight decreases by 0.5-1.0 kg daily 2
  • Loop diuretics remain effective at eGFR 40 (unlike thiazides which lose effectiveness below creatinine clearance of 40 mL/min) 3, 1
  • Switch to twice-daily dosing rather than once-daily, as this is superior in patients with reduced GFR 1
  • Higher doses (up to 10-15 mg/day bumetanide) may be required in chronic kidney disease 3, 4

If edema persists despite increased bumetanide:

  • Add metolazone 2.5-10 mg once daily to achieve sequential nephron blockade by blocking distal tubular sodium reabsorption 3, 1, 2
  • Alternative thiazide combinations include hydrochlorothiazide 25-100 mg or chlorothiazide IV 500-1000 mg 3

Critical Sodium Restriction

Sodium restriction is MORE important than fluid restriction for managing volume status in renal failure:

  • Limit sodium to <100 mmol/day (2.3 g sodium or 6 g salt per day) 5
  • Attempting fluid restriction without adequate sodium restriction is futile—excessive sodium stimulates thirst and isotonic fluid gain 5
  • Reinforce that dietary sodium restriction to ≤2 grams daily greatly assists maintenance of volume balance 2

Fluid Management Based on Urine Output

Individualize fluid restriction based on oliguria vs polyuria:

  • If oligoanuric (minimal urine output): Calculate daily fluid allowance as insensible losses (400 mL/m² or 20 mL/kg/day) plus 24-hour urine output plus additional losses 5
  • If polyuric with salt-wasting: May actually require supplemental fluids and sodium rather than restriction 5
  • Monitor 24-hour urine output to guide this decision 5

Monitoring Parameters and Acceptable Changes

Accept modest increases in creatinine during aggressive diuresis:

  • Small to moderate elevations in renal function parameters should NOT lead to reducing diuretic intensity, provided renal function stabilizes 2
  • Accept up to 30% increase in serum creatinine during diuresis, as this often reflects appropriate volume reduction rather than true kidney injury 1
  • Continue diuresis until fluid retention is eliminated, even if mild-to-moderate decreases in blood pressure or renal function occur 2

Monitor electrolytes closely:

  • Check serum potassium, magnesium, and sodium regularly—bumetanide causes depletion that predisposes to serious arrhythmias 2, 6
  • Hypokalemia is the most common electrolyte abnormality with loop diuretics 1
  • Consider potassium supplementation or adding spironolactone (with careful potassium monitoring at eGFR 40) 3, 1

Important Caveats at eGFR 40

Dose adjustment considerations:

  • At eGFR 30-44 (Stage G3b), bumetanide dosing does NOT need to be reduced—loop diuretics maintain efficacy with impaired renal function 3, 1
  • Reversible elevations of BUN and creatinine may occur, especially with dehydration, but this should not prevent adequate diuresis 6

Avoid common pitfalls:

  • Review for NSAIDs (including COX-2 inhibitors) which block diuretic effects and can precipitate diuretic resistance 2, 6
  • Excessive concern about hypotension and azotemia leads to underutilization of diuretics and refractory edema 2
  • Persistent volume overload itself attenuates diuretic response 2

Alternative Considerations

If truly diuretic-resistant despite maximal therapy:

  • Consider ultrafiltration or hemofiltration 5
  • Evaluate for secondary causes of edema (venous insufficiency, medication-related such as calcium channel blockers, hypoalbuminemia) 3

Nephrology referral indicated if:

  • Progressive decline in eGFR (>5 mL/min/1.73 m²/year) 3
  • Refractory edema despite sequential nephron blockade 1
  • Development of complications requiring renal replacement therapy 3
